GraphQL 查询,根据某些条件使用片段。加载 GraphQL 文件
GraphQL query, use fragment depending on some condition. GraphQL file loaded
有一个任务根据角色请求一个对象的不同字段。假设管理员可以查看一组指标。其他用户可以看到另一组指标。任务是仅请求用户可以查看的指标。 React 应用程序正在使用 graphQL 文件加载器,它应该保持这种状态。
现在有两个graphql文件。在定义的其他片段上 - 使用片段导入进行查询。是否有可能根据条件更改使用的片段?
你试过指令吗?他们可能会在这种情况下帮助您。请参考文档:http://graphql.org/learn/queries/#directives
有一个任务根据角色请求一个对象的不同字段。假设管理员可以查看一组指标。其他用户可以看到另一组指标。任务是仅请求用户可以查看的指标。 React 应用程序正在使用 graphQL 文件加载器,它应该保持这种状态。
现在有两个graphql文件。在定义的其他片段上 - 使用片段导入进行查询。是否有可能根据条件更改使用的片段?
你试过指令吗?他们可能会在这种情况下帮助您。请参考文档:http://graphql.org/learn/queries/#directives